What Is Longevity?

Longevity is about helping people live healthier for a time. It is not about living longer but also about living a healthy life. Longevity aims to improve the number of years a person’s physically, mentally and emotionally healthy.

A Longevity Centre is a place where people can get help to live healthier. They do this by finding out what health problems a person might have in helping people make better lifestyle choices, keeping the body working well and making a plan that is just right for each person to stay active as they get older.

These days longevity programmes often include checking a person’s health, doing tests to find out what is going on inside the body, giving advice on what to eat, suggesting exercises to help people recover when they are sick and using therapies to keep people healthy for a long time. 

What Is Anti-Ageing?

Anti-ageing is mainly about making people look younger. This can include things like making skin look smoother, getting rid of wrinkles, making faces look fuller, making skin more elastic and making people look better overall.

Many people choose anti-ageing treatments to maintain healthy-looking skin and boost their confidence.  These treatments can make people look better. They might not fix the underlying health problems that make people look older.

The Main Difference Between Longevity and Anti-Ageing

The difference between Longevity and Anti-Ageing is what they are trying to do. Longevity is about making the Longevity of a person by keeping their body healthy so they can stay healthy and active as they get older. Anti-Ageing is mainly about making people look better on the outside.

Where Does Longevity Skincare Fit In?

Healthy skin is a sign of health.

Skincare cannot stop ageing. Longevity skincare is about keeping skin healthy. This means keeping skin hydrated, helping skin to work properly, making collagen and protecting skin from damage.

When people eat well, sleep enough, manage stress, drink water and take care of their skin it all works together to help them age well both inside and out.
